Jolly Roger friendly triples - Saturday 29 April 

Each year Camberwell Petanque Club and Mt Macedon Petanque Club compete in the Jolly Roger - a friendly triples competition. This year we're hosting Mt Macedon on Saturday 29 April. Registration opens 9:30am and play starts at 10:00am. Four games with a random draw are played, with a lunch break after the second game. Lunch is provided by us. 

Expressions of interest are invited to join this fun day. Once we know how many players are coming from Mt Macedon we will form the same number of teams from interested CPC players on a first in basis.

Our winners

Congratulations to our members and their playing partners in recent competitions. Some notable results were:

  • Marija and Bastien won the Dove Mixed Doubles on 12 March winning over 27 other pairs. Five teams from CPC competed. 
  • Libby and David were thrilled to win the Flinders March competition on 12 March. They were one of only two teams to win all three games. 
  • Vinz, Robert and Guy finished in the top five in the Men's Over 60 division at the VPCI Singles Championships on 26 March.
  • Lynn and Patrick Dufresne won the Nagambie Mixed Doubles on 2 April in a field of 25  (Lynn is on the right with the beaming smile).

Recognition for CPC

We have been granted bronze accreditation in the new Boroondara Council Sports Club Accreditation program. Only ten sports club were granted accreditation for 2023-24. The program recognises the club for meeting its reporting requirements and providing a safe and welcoming environment.
